probleme interresant qui porte a reflexion

probleme interresant qui porte a reflexion - Shell/Batch - Programmation

Marsh Posté le 03-08-2006 à 22:30:13    

voila mon probleme je possede un batc nomé tati.bat je voudrai executer un code dans celui ci qui ecrit dans un nouveau batch appeler essai.bat
essai.bat sert a deplacer tati.bat sur le bureau et a le lancer j'explique avec mon code:
 
 
@echo off
echo move "tati.bat" "C:\Documents and Settings\%username%\Bureau\">essai.bat
echo exit>>essai.bat
start essai.bat
 
le probleme c'est que si tati.bat est sur le bureau et continue son cour tout se passe bien...
si tati.bat est autre part il est copié sur le bureau mais il ne continue pas a executer les commande inclu dans tati.bat
qui aurait une solution???
 
c'est du lourd la mercii

Reply

Marsh Posté le 03-08-2006 à 22:30:13   

Reply

Marsh Posté le 04-08-2006 à 12:55:26    

personne ne sait faire sa??? c'est peutetre impossible

Reply

Marsh Posté le 04-08-2006 à 15:48:37    

je ne prog pas en batch, n en shell, mais peut etre que ta premiere ligne de essai.bat serait de fermer tati.bat
puis d'effectuer son changement d'emplacement ?

Reply

Marsh Posté le 04-08-2006 à 16:05:17    

nightwar a écrit :

voila mon probleme je possede un batc nomé tati.bat je voudrai executer un code dans celui ci qui ecrit dans un nouveau batch appeler essai.bat
essai.bat sert a deplacer tati.bat sur le bureau et a le lancer j'explique avec mon code


Tu pourrais reformuler s.t.p., avec ponctuation, accents, grammaire et tout ça ? Je ne parviens pas à comprendre.   [:pingouino]  


---------------
Now Playing: {SYNTAX ERROR AT LINE 1210}
Reply

Marsh Posté le 04-08-2006 à 19:28:42    

ok je reformule:
je veux ecrire un programme en batch qui se nomme tati.bat
ce programme contient des instructions
je veux rajouter certaines instructions au debut de tati.bat piour que celui ci s'autodeplace sur mon bureau..
alors pour cela je crée un nouveau bat (toujour a partir de tati.bat) qui sexecute et qui a comme instruction de deplacer tati.bat
le probleme est que cela ne fonctionne pas merci de m'aider svp
jpcheck je n'ai pas compri ton aide :s

Reply

Marsh Posté le 04-08-2006 à 23:01:31    

Fait une copie, puis supprime l'ancien.


Message édité par webding le 04-08-2006 à 23:01:38
Reply

Marsh Posté le 04-08-2006 à 23:08:54    

c'est ce que j'ai fait mais le programme ne suit pas son cour surement parce qu'il a été deplacer

Reply

Marsh Posté le 04-08-2006 à 23:09:41    

a non trés bonne reflexion merci a toi :d

Reply

Marsh Posté le 04-08-2006 à 23:20:35    

nightwar a écrit :

a non trés bonne reflexion merci a toi :d


 
 
Donc a marche maitenant c'est ca ?

Reply

Marsh Posté le 04-08-2006 à 23:28:35    

no lol jessaye ce que tu me propose c'est trés compliquer...

Reply

Marsh Posté le 04-08-2006 à 23:28:35   

Reply

Marsh Posté le 11-08-2006 à 21:08:02    

lu :)
je suis pas sur mais je pense qu'il aime pas trop le documents and settings :) pareil pour mes documents... c est mal pris en compte par le progr :)
choisi une adresse sans espace :)
si ca marche c est que c est le Documents and Settings qui marche pas :)
 
un autre truc :) le >essait.bat c est pas genial :p
apres le > tu doit mettre une adresse genre  
echo echo salut > C:\test.bat
 
bonne soirer a tous ;)

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ed